If I remember correctly, rescue mode isn't even *mentioned* in the F1-Help screens when booting from the CD! While there *is* an auto-GRUB-thing hidden in the expert installation menu, realistically most people won't find it because they won't think to look there for recovery options.
I think it's a good step to clearly include "Rescue" or "Bootloader reinstallation" options in the help screens at bootup. Also, this feature should mention what appears to be on each partition. Currently Rescue Mode only shows you "meaningless" partition numbers.
